Abstract

Background: Acetabular fractures are complex injuries that may result in poor hip function, arthritis, and long-term disability if not accurately reduced and fixed. Quadrilateral plate (QP) involvement increases fracture complexity and is often associated with medial femoral head displacement. Aim was to compare the functional and radiological outcomes of unstable acetabular fractures with and without QP involvement among surgically treated patients at NITOR, Dhaka.

Methods: This hospital-based comparative observational study was conducted in the Department of Orthopaedic Surgery, National Institute of Traumatology and Orthopaedic Rehabilitation, Dhaka, Bangladesh, from January 2024 to January 2026. Thirty patients with surgically treated unstable acetabular fractures were divided into two groups: with QP involvement (n=18) and without QP involvement (n=12). Demographic, clinical, radiological, operative, and follow-up data were analyzed using SPSS version 26.0, with p<0.05 considered significant.

Results: Patients with QP involvement had significantly more complex fracture patterns (p=0.012), greater preoperative displacement (8.4±2.7 mm vs 5.9±1.8 mm, p=0.008), and more frequent medial femoral head displacement (72.2% vs 16.7%, p=0.008). Operative duration (176.4±34.5 vs 142.5±28.7 minutes, p=0.008) and blood loss (780.0±210.0 vs 560.0±175.0 ml, p=0.005) were significantly higher. Excellent/good functional outcomes (61.1% vs 83.3%) and radiological outcomes (61.1% vs 83.4%) were lower, while complications were more frequent (38.9% vs 16.7%).

Conclusions: QP involvement was associated with greater fracture complexity, increased operative difficulty, and a trend toward poorer outcomes, highlighting the importance of meticulous preoperative planning, stable fixation, and close follow-up.
